getzski: Agree. We will run the electrical wires near ceiling.

did you do back to back electrical points?

e.g. if you run the electrical trunking in the room, to the room electrical point. From that point, you can add an adjoining point in the living room. this will reduce any unnesscary trunking in the living room.

END OF DAY SIX

Demolition work and electrical wires are 100% completed. The workers have removed the bulky items - kitchen cabinets, and some debris. They should be clearing the balance debris tomorrow, otherwise they can't lay the cement and sand. Hubby went to the house and took some pictures:
